On Thu, Feb 2, 2017 at 6:28 PM, Jason Gustafson <ja...@confluent.io> wrote:

> Took me a while to remember why we didn't do this. The timestamp that is
> included at the message set level is the max timestamp of all messages in
> the message set as is the case in the current message format (I will update
> the document to make this explicit). We could make the message timestamps
> relative to the max timestamp, but that makes serialization a bit awkward
> since the timestamps are not assumed to be increasing sequentially or
> monotonically. Once the messages in the message set had been determined, we
> would need to go back and adjust the relative timestamps.
>

Yes, I thought this would be a bit tricky and hence why I mentioned the
option of adding a new field at the message set level for the first
timestamp even though that's not ideal either.

Here's one idea. We let the timestamps in the messages be varints, but we
> make their values be relative to the timestamp of the previous message,
> with the timestamp of the first message being absolute. For example, if we
> had timestamps 500, 501, 499, then we would write 500 for the first
> message, 1 for the next, and -2 for the final message. Would that work? Let
> me think a bit about it and see if there are any problems.
>

It's an interesting idea. Comparing to the option of having the first
timestamp in the message set, It's a little more space efficient as we
don't have both a full timestamp in the message set _and_ a varint in the
first message (which would always be 0, so we avoid the extra byte) and
also the deltas could be a little smaller in the common case. The main
downside is that it introduces a semantics inconsistency between the first
message and the rest. Not ideal, but maybe we can live with that.
